phanotron

[ fan-uh-tron ]

noun

Electronics.
  1. a hot-cathode gas diode.


Discover More

Word History and Origins

Origin of phanotron1

1930–35; perhaps < Greek phan ( á𾱲 ) to appear + -o- -o- + -tron
